Publication number: 20260004385Abstract: An image processing circuit is coupled to an image sensor and includes a first memory, a second memory, an image receiving circuit, and a memory access circuit. The image receiving circuit is configured to receive an image from the image sensor and store the image in the first memory. The memory access circuit is configured to write the image from the first memory into the second memory. When the image receiving circuit stores the image in the first memory, the image processing circuit operates in a low-speed mode, and when the memory access circuit writes the image from the first memory into the second memory, the image processing circuit operates in a high-speed mode. The first operating speed of the second memory in the low-speed mode is lower than the second operating speed of the second memory in the high-speed mode.Type: ApplicationFiled: May 29, 2025Publication date: January 1, 2026Inventors: Fu-Cheng CHEN, Wen-Nan HUANG

Patent number: 11665318Abstract: The present disclosure discloses an object detection method used in an object detection apparatus that includes the steps outlined below. An image signal received from an image sensor is detected to generate an image detection signal when an image variation is detected. An infrared signal received from an infrared sensor is detected to generate an infrared detection signal when an infrared energy variation is detected. A time counting process is initialized when the image detection signal is generated. An object detection signal is generated when the infrared detection signal is generated within a predetermined time period after the time counting process is initialized. A detection distance of the image sensor is larger than a detection distance of the infrared sensor.Type: GrantFiled: December 1, 2021Date of Patent: May 30, 2023Assignee: SIGMASTAR TECHNOLOGY LTD.Inventors: Fu-Cheng Chen, Yih-Ru Tsai, Po-Jung Chen

Patent number: 11647280Abstract: The present disclosure discloses a dual-processor electronic apparatus operation method used in a dual-processor electronic apparatus that includes steps outlined below. A first processor is activated in an initialization procedure. A second processor is activated by the first processor to enter an operation mode. The first processor is deactivated in the operation mode, and the second processor executes a predetermined procedure. Whether a predetermined event occurs during the execution of the predetermined procedure is determined by the second processor such that event information is stored when the predetermined event occurs and the first processor is activated. The event information is accessed and processed by the first processor.Type: GrantFiled: December 28, 2021Date of Patent: May 9, 2023Assignee: SIGMASTAR TECHNOLOGY LTD.Inventors: Fu-Cheng Chen, Chao-Kai Chang, Yao-Chang Hsieh

Patent number: 11435922Abstract: A control method for a storage device of a driving recorder includes: configuring a directory entry of a storage device according to a predetermined directory entry stored in a storage unit; configuring a file allocation table of the storage device according to a predetermined file allocation table stored in the storage unit; and controlling a controller to write data to the storage device according to the directory entry and the file allocation table. In one embodiment, entries of the predetermined file allocation table are interleaved to accommodate multiple files and still support a continuous write operation.Type: GrantFiled: August 5, 2020Date of Patent: September 6, 2022Assignee: SIGMASTAR TECHNOLOGY LTD.Inventors: Chia-Jung Lee, Fu-Cheng Chen, Chun-Nan Lu

Patent number: 9835897Abstract: A display module includes a light source and a display unit. The light source has an emission spectrum having maximum peak values corresponding to a first maximum peak wavelength and a second maximum peak wavelength. The display unit includes a green filter layer having a transmittance spectrum. The emission spectrum and the transmittance spectrum have a right cross-point and a left cross-point. A product of an emission intensity value of the emission spectrum corresponding to the right cross-point and a transmittance intensity value of the transmittance spectrum corresponding to the right cross-point is a first product value. A product of an emission intensity value of the emission spectrum corresponding to the left cross-point and a transmittance intensity value of the transmittance spectrum corresponding to the left cross-point is a second product value. A ratio of the first product value to the second product value is less than 20%.Type: GrantFiled: February 4, 2016Date of Patent: December 5, 2017Assignee: INNOLUX CORPORATIONInventors: Fu-Cheng Chen, Jeng-Wei Yeh, Kuei-Ling Liu

Publication number: 20160171920Abstract: A display apparatus includes a display panel and a driving module. The driving module is electrically connected with the display panel and has an image processing circuit and a data driving circuit. The image processing circuit receives a first image signal of a frame time. When an average gray level of the first image signal is greater than or equal to a first setting gray level, the image processing circuit reduces gray levels of the first image signal according to a first ratio to obtain a second image signal. The data driving circuit receives the second image signal and drives the display panel to display an image according to the second image signal. An image control method of the display panel is also disclosed.Type: ApplicationFiled: February 23, 2016Publication date: June 16, 2016Inventors: Cheng-Chung YANG, Fu-Cheng CHEN, Yu-Heng YANG

Patent number: 9285627Abstract: A display module having a light source includes a display unit. The display unit includes a first substrate, a second substrate opposite to the first substrate, a display medium and a green filter layer. The display medium is disposed between the first substrate and the second substrate. The green filter layer is disposed on the first substrate or the second substrate. When the wavelength of the light is between 380 nm and 780 nm, the spectrum of the light source passing through the green filter layer corresponds to a first energy. When the wavelength of the light is between interval of 660 and 780 nm, the spectrum of the light source passing through the green filter layer corresponds to a second energy. The ratio of the second energy to the first energy is less than 2%.Type: GrantFiled: October 16, 2013Date of Patent: March 15, 2016Assignee: INNOLUX CORPORATIONInventors: Fu-Cheng Chen, Jeng-Wei Yeh, Kuei-Ling Liu
